How Masi’s Approaches Work Online

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) helps people get clear about what matters to them and take action toward those values even when difficult feelings are present. It often helps with anxiety, low mood, and motivation struggles.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) focuses on practical strategies to notice and shift unhelpful thoughts and behaviors, which can ease symptoms of depression, panic, and sleep problems.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) provides concrete skills for managing intense emotions, reducing impulsivity, and improving interpersonal effectiveness.
